  • Day 1: Start your Seattle adventure at the Seattle Waterfront, where you can enjoy stunning views of Elliott Bay and visit the iconic Pike Place Market. After exploring the market, make your way to the Seattle Central Library, a marvel of modern architecture with unique designs and impressive collections. Conclude your day in Pioneer Square, the historic heart of Seattle, where you can enjoy art galleries, boutique shops, and cozy cafes while soaking in the charming atmosphere.
  • Day 2: Kick off your day at the Space Needle for breathtaking panoramic views of the city and Mount Rainier. After taking in the sights, stroll down to Pier 69, where you can enjoy the waterfront and perhaps catch a ferry for a scenic ride. Wrap up your day at The Spheres, located at the Amazon headquarters, where you can wander through a lush indoor rainforest and explore the unique plant life.
  • Day 3: Begin at the Seattle Center, home to numerous attractions including the Museum of Pop Culture and the Chihuly Garden and Glass. From there, head over to WaMu Theater, where you can check out any live performances or events happening during your visit. Finish your adventure in the Seattle Central Business District, where you can shop at local stores, dine in trendy restaurants, and experience the vibrant urban vibe that defines Seattle.

What to eat near Lumen Field

Here are some must-try dishes near Lumen Field, Seattle, Washington, United States of America:

  • Clam Chowder: A Seattle staple, this creamy soup features fresh clams, potatoes, onions, and celery, often served in a bread bowl. It's perfect for warming up on a cool day and reflects the region's rich maritime heritage, often enjoyed at waterfront eateries.
  • Sushi: Seattle has a vibrant sushi scene, thanks to its proximity to the Pacific Ocean. Local sushi spots serve fresh, high-quality fish, including salmon and tuna, highlighting the city’s connection to the ocean. Many places offer a personal touch, allowing diners to customize their rolls with various ingredients.
  • Burger: The Pacific Northwest is known for its gourmet burgers, often featuring grass-fed beef and local toppings like avocado or artisan cheeses. Enjoying a burger at Lumen Field is a casual yet delicious way to experience the region's culinary creativity.
